Unless you honestly plan to shoot a mile often and really need it to shine at that distance I’d personally opt for a 6.5.

In cheaper factory rifles I’m a tikka fan. Otherwise I shoot my AI’s or would just build.

What’s the budget for the rifle? A tikka CTR will be a great starter if your around $1000-$1200 for the rifle

Otherwise shop the px here for a setup

Edit: I’m not saying don’t get the 300 PRC. It’s a hell of a cartridge. Just understand the cost and recoil difference if you don’t necessarily need the extra power

I started with a Savage criterion barreled action in 260 Remington and have taken that over a mile with success. No it’s not the ideal cartridge but for the amount of times I shot that distance vs 1000 or closer it was just fine

For a decent cheaper optic I’m liking my DNT. Otherwise Athlon is a good bet. The Ares and Cronus line are great

for 1000 and the odd time at a mile I'd look at 6.5 or even 7 PRC. I'd go for the Bergara over the Browning.
CVA actually came out with some decent rifles for reasonable also that are a touch cheaper than a Bergara.

Athlon Cronus is a really good scope for the money, could go to an Ares ETR for a bit cheaper. Even a Midas Tac if you wanted. Gonna wanna put it in a mount with some cant to get all the elevation out of it
